Council Member Crystal Larios was elected to the Vernon City Council in June 2021 to serve in an unexpired term and was elected to serve her first full five-year term in Office in April 2024.  Her term in office expires in April 2029.  As a public official of the City, Council Member Larios is committed to leading with honesty and compassion and serving as a faithful advocate of Vernon’s residents while maintaining their trust in the City’s government.

A native of the Southeast Los Angeles region, she is familiar with the socio-economic plight faced by many of the families that reside in the area and hopes to assist and uplift Vernon’s residential community to its highest potential.  Council Member Larios values the economic benefits and opportunity that businesses represent and supports the City’s pursuit of more balanced land uses and clean commerce.  She envisions the development of clean businesses as a way to bolster the City’s economic future while better serving the environment and community.

Council Member Larios prides herself on being an independent thinker who will work alongside her fellow Council Members to set policies that will guide management in the pursuit of a brighter future for the City.  She appreciates the opportunity to give back and aspires to instill a sense of community and pride in Vernon’s residents and businesses for many years to come.

Council Member Larios represents the City on the Board of Directors for Los Angeles County Sanitation District 23 and other regional boards including the Gateway Cities Council of Governments.

Council Member Larios received a Bachelor of Science in Society and Environment with a concentration in U.S. Environmental Policy and Management from the esteemed University of California, Berkley and is currently a Principal Contract Administrator for professional services and goods at the Los Angeles County Metropolitan Transportation Authority (Metro).
